Read allPerla is a teenager who has been prostituted by her mother, Tomasa and acts as a dancer in a cabaret-brothel. The pianist who plays at the venue is a romantic singer-songwriter and inveterate poet who would like to make art out of a sordid situation. When "el Marro", a sick sailor stops at the place and falls in love with the girl, the mother tries to cut off that rel... Read all

    I liked this incredibly obscure movie.

    I got a tape of this movie from an inmate at a federal prison who is a student of one of my friends. The tape I saw was created after the film was a choice for the Cannes Film Festival in 1991. The inmate claims that he was inspired by Rashomon, because the story is told from the viewpoint of three different people. I enjoyed this as a story of how a woman survives poverty to bring happiness to those she loves.
